There are a few upsides to an expanded playoff.
First is that it might make more players participate in their team's bowl game (because there is still a chance to "win it all")
And Second, it might help even out the talent a little bit more, as the whole "I went to Alabama because I want to compete for championships" will be a little a less exclusive, as now 8 teams would be able to have an opportunity to win as opposed to 2-teams with the BCS and 4-teams with the CFP.
Yes, I understand that people will argue that that is what the season is all about, and to that I would argue the a) it's not long enough given the size of the league, b) it's not even long enough given the size of a single conference, and c) why do you hate football and fun?
An expanded playoff is an absolute inevitability, the real question is, will it be in the next 2-4 years or 8-10 years?
